About Ozzy

Ozzy is a animation, family film released in 2016 exploring themes of dog, beagle. Directed by Alberto Rodríguez, it stars Guillermo Romero, Dani Rovira, José Mota. Ozzy, a friendly, peaceful beagle has his idyllic life turned upside down when the Martins leave on a long and distant trip. There's only one problem: no dogs allowed! Unable to bring their beloved Ozzy along for the ride, they settle on the next best thing, a top-of-the-line canine spa called Blue Creek.
